Nature of Work

The selected candidates will work in a highly interdisciplinary environment, involving collaboration with:

Medical College and Hospital
Artificial Intelligence (AI)
Machine Learning (ML)
Robotics and computational biology groups
The project integrates in-silico, in-vitro, in-vivo, and patient-derived sample analyses for theragnostic development in Parkinson’s disease.
